Output 62f51af0a5c425df831a4a5dd54ea435a449ca7cdd79845913427c44db631524:0

value
76368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fcfc2b06ccf92a836a418db0fe479ba5b6b0101 OP_EQUAL
address
3KBDsdrjMBNv8z6F9QeT4nyWyaXs8cymgS
transaction
62f51af0a5c425df831a4a5dd54ea435a449ca7cdd79845913427c44db631524